A wide-flange column transition splice connection joins upper wide-flange column A to lower wide-flange column B using a horizontal transitional butt plate. The butt plate thickness is sized to be the largest of half the lower flange thickness or one and a half inches minimum, matching the flange width of the wide-flange column. The plate surface is milled for full bearing with partial-joint-penetration welds typically specified between k-regions. Both column ends are milled square, and the splice line is positioned four feet minimum above the top of steel.
